Chapter 12 I decide to give Rhys the night off, feeding an excuse to my family that he's on a video call with his family while they open his gifts. Meanwhile, I'm forced on a nonnegotiable family outing to the tree lighting in the center of the resort. The pine tree stands tall in the courtyard behind the lodge, the tip of it so high I have to crane my neck to see the bright star. Liam, with his rosy-red cheeks, is on top of my dad's shoulders to see better. Marcus acts like a child and secretly throws snowballs at the back of my sister's head to piss her off.

I laugh under my breath every time the powder explodes against her coat. Until he hits me. "Marcus." I spin with gritted teeth. "Don't play with me. You know I'll get you back." Cold snow slides down my neck and underneath the back of my sweater. A chill works through me, and I can't help but bend down to make my own snowball. "I would be afraid if your boyfriend was here." Marcus chuckles. "But he's not. Did he break up with you already?" I roll my eyes, all while packing my snowball tighter.

"If he did, it'd be because of how crazy my family is." Marcus makes the mistake of taking his eyes from me. I palm the snowball a few times until passersby move out of the way. When the coast is clear, I wind my arm back and send it flying. It smacks him on the side of his head, and my laughter erupts. "Mira!" my mom scolds me, but I truly couldn't care less. Maybe it's the random orgasm that Rhys gave me, or maybe it's just Rhys's presence in general. Either way, I'm much more chipper today than I've ever been while on a family trip.

I fake an apology to my mom and turn away from my brother. There's a weird pang in my stomach that comes with the thought of Rhys. Do I miss him? No. Surely not. It would be insane to miss my fake boyfriend, right? And it's not like he's gone. He's just taking a break from being forced to do my stuff. "Hey, Mira... isn't that your boyfriend?" My brother's tone is laced with amusement. But I'm not stupid enough to fall for his tricks. "Nice try, Marcus," I call over my shoulder.

"I know the second I turn around, you're going to hit me dead center in the face with a snowball." "Boy...fwiend!" Liam claps his hands while my dad holds him steady on his shoulders. Butterflies fill my stomach, and warmth rushes in. Why did I just get butterflies? I follow Liam's line of sight, forgetting all about Marcus and our snowball fight, and spin over the slippery ground. "Think fast!" Marcus shouts. My hands fly up to block the hit, but nothing comes. Someone grabs my wrists and slowly pulls my face free. I blink several times before snapping out of my trance.

Rhys stands in front of me with the hottest smirk I've ever seen. "Need some backup, Frostbite?" Excitement forces a real smile onto my face. Rhys jerks slightly at the sight of it. "You should smile more often," he whispers. "It's a pretty one." A knot forms in my throat from the compliment. Does he mean that? Or is he just playing along with the whole boyfriend thing? "Bro, I'm sorry. I didn't mean to hit you." Rhys drops my wrists and wraps his arm around my waist. "I know. You were trying to hit my girl." My cheeks burst with heat. His girl. Marcus shrugs sheepishly.

I wrinkle my nose at him. "Do you want some hot cocoa, too?" My dad grabs his wallet and offers me money. "Hurry before your sister sees and tells us he can't have sugar." I laugh and reach forward for the money, but Rhys quickly tugs me backward. "I've got it. Anyone else want some?" Marcus pipes up. "Me." Rhys glances at him.

"Only if you stop throwing snowballs at my girlfriend." "Done." I roll my eyes at my brother before heading towards the hot cocoa stand. Once we're out of earshot, I peek at him. "What are you doing here? I gave you the night off." Rhys blows air out of his puffed-up cheeks. "We've got a problem, Frostbite." Panic forces me to stop walking. "You want to break up?" Shit. My heart jolts, and I fear it's the beginning of an upcoming heartbreak from my fake boyfriend breaking up with me, which means I'm more delusional than I thought. "Okay," I start babbling. "We will need a plan.

Maybe make a scene? We can get into a big fight." My teeth sink into my lip as I think of reasons for our fight. "Maybe you can say that you don't want a commitment⁠-" Rhys grips my chin, his hold firm but steady. Silence takes over. His thumb frees my lip from my teeth, and his eyes shift back and forth between mine. "I don't want to break up. We haven't even had sex yet." He's joking. I think. He gently skims his thumb against my lip. "I expected a refusal or, at the very least, a scoff." His eyebrow rises beneath his beanie.

"Interesting." The snow under my boots makes a noise with my shifting. I wouldn't be surprised if it started to melt from the heat brewing between my legs at the thought of having sex with Rhys. I clear my throat. "No breakup, then. What's the problem?" Rhys glances back and forth. "You know how I came here with my friends? Well, they're starting to notice my more-than-usual absence, and Briar brought up coming to this thing. I couldn't really get out of it since I haven't spent any time with them." Oh. Oh.

"And they can't really see you with me and my family, or else they'll be wondering why you suddenly have a girlfriend," I finish. He nods. "And your family can't see me with them and not you." "Shit," I mutter. Suddenly, I feel bad. I've been monopolizing his time for this lie. I didn't even consider that he came to hang out with his friends. My shoulders fall, and I drop my gaze to our boots. "I'm sorry, Rhys. This is all my fault." "Hey." He gives me a little shake. "None of that." His finger lands on my chin, and he tips my head back. I stare into his eyes and instantly feel calmer.

"Playing the role of your boyfriend has made this trip interesting." His grin is infectious. "Plus, I got to finger you on the slopes. No regrets there. Now, we just need to keep up appearances for your family while avoiding my friends, and I need to slip away to show my face with them. It's doable. Like juggling. Or lying to your family about being able to snowboard." I huff with annoyance, but it's fake. I don't know how he does it, but I lose my bad mood in his presence. "Oh shit." Rhys grabs my hand. Suddenly, we're running. Me and running on the slippery snow? Is he out of his mind?

"Rhys!" I squeal. "I'm going to fall!" "Not on my watch." He jerks to a stop and bends down in front of me. "Climb on, baby. We gotta take cover." "What?" I peer over my shoulder, and my gaze lands on a group of people our age. "Are those your friends?" "Yes! Now get on my back." I climb on quickly, and his arms wrap around my calves. I squeeze tight, enveloping him with my arms. My face is buried in the crook of his neck, and the dirtiest thought slips in. What would he do if I started to kiss him there? I lose track of where his hurried pace takes us.

Through a throng of people, back inside the lodge, we're immediately enveloped in warmth...then darkness. Rhys shuts a door and moves us away from the windows. "Where the fuck are we?" he mutters, still holding on to my legs. I peek around, and although there aren't any lights, I know exactly where we are. "Santa's workshop." I laugh quietly. "It's a cute little cottage that the resort has set up during the day for kids to walk through." "Explains why my head is almost touching the ceiling," he mumbles. I bury my face into his neck again, trying to conceal my laughter.

"Oh, you think this is funny?" he asks, amused. A breathy laugh leaves my mouth, landing right over the spot on his neck that was tempting me no more than a few seconds ago. "I can make it even funnier," I tease. Before I give him a chance to question me, I press my mouth beneath his jaw and kiss him. His pulse quickly picks up speed and pounds against my lips. "Mira, Mira, Mira." Rhys tsks his tongue while moving his head to the side to give me better access.

"Are you trying to get me all hot and bothered in Santa's workshop?" "Who, me?" I pepper his neck with light kisses until I get to the stubble on his sharp jaw. He turns slightly, our mouths a breath away. "You're going to end up on the naughty list if you keep that up." His voice is strained. And I can't help but love the sound. I smile shyly. "Good."
